WebFacts of the case. In 1965, six agents of the Federal Bureau of Narcotics forced their way into Webster Bivens’ home without a warrant and searched the premises. Bills numbers restart every two years. … WebJun 8, 2024 · The claims, known as “ Bivens claims,” are federal analogs to a 42 U.S. Code § 1983 civil rights action against state actors. They require that a plaintiff either assert an established set of rights that were violated — or that a court allow an “extension” of allowable Bivens claims. WebApr 6, 2024 · Put more simply, a Bivens action is a lawsuit against a government official who violates someone’s constitutional rights. WebMesa, 140 S. Ct. 735, 742 (2024) (discussing the petitioners’ arguments [a]nalogizing Bivens to the work of a common-law court); Correctional Services Corp. v. Malesko, 534 U.S. 61, 75 (2001) (Scalia, J., concurring) (stating that Bivens is a relic of the heady days in which this Court assumed common-law powers to create causes of action).
